`ABSTRACT
`(57)
`An approach for selecting sets of communications channels
`involves determining the performance of communications
`channels. A set of channels is selected based on the results
`of performance testing and specified criteria. The participant
`generates data that identifies the selected set of channels and
`provides that data to other participants of the communica(cid:173)
`tions network. The participants communicate over the set of
`channels, such as by using a frequency hopping protocol.
`When a specified time expires or monitoring of the perfor(cid:173)
`mance of the channel set identifies poor performance of the
`set of channels, the participant selects another set of chan(cid:173)
`nels for use in communications based on additional perfor(cid:173)
`mance testing. By selecting channels based on the initial
`performance testing and performance monitoring, the com(cid:173)
`munications network adaptively avoids channels with poor
`performance.
